Ronald Zubar was born on September 20, 1985 in Les Abymes, Guadeloupe. From a young age, he showed exceptional talent in soccer and quickly rose through the ranks of the sport. He made his senior debut for Caen in 2002, where he started to make a name for himself as a promising defender.
Zubar's career has been defined by his time at various clubs, including Caen, the Wolverhampton Wanderers, and the New York Red Bulls. He made a significant impact at each club, showcasing his defensive skills and leadership on the field. His performances earned him recognition, such as being named to the Ligue 2 UNFP Team of the Year for the 2005-06 season.
Zubar has represented France at the international level, as well as its overseas region of Guadeloupe. His passion for the game and dedication to his craft have been evident in his performances on the international stage.
Zubar comes from a family of soccer players, with his brother Stephane Zubar also making a name for himself in the sport. The Zubar brothers' shared love for soccer has been a source of inspiration and support for both players throughout their careers.
